JavaScript Carousel Tutorial: Kako ustvariti vrtiljak za vašo spletno stran
Ste že kdaj pomislili, kako bi lahko dodali dinamičen in interaktiven vrtiljak slik na vašo spletno stran? Z uporabo JavaScript-a je to enostavno! V tem članku vam bomo pokazali, kako ustvariti preprost in funkcionalen JavaScript carousel, ki bo izboljšal uporabniško izkušnjo in izgled vaše strani. Ne skrbite, tudi če ste začetnik – vse bomo razložili na preprost način!
Kaj je JavaScript Carousel?
Preden začnemo s kodiranjem, si oglejmo, kaj sploh pomeni "carousel" v spletnem dizajnu. Carousel je vrtiljak, običajno v obliki slik ali besedila, ki se samodejno premika ali pa omogoča uporabniku, da premika vsebino ročno. V spletnih straneh se pogosto uporablja za prikazovanje več slik, promocijskih oglasov ali drugih vsebin na enostaven in vizualno privlačen način.
Zakaj uporabiti JavaScript za ustvarjanje Carousela?
Obstajajo različni načini za ustvarjanje carousela na spletnih straneh, vendar je uporaba JavaScript-a ena izmed najbolj priljubljenih metod. Zakaj? Ker JavaScript omogoča dinamične in interaktivne funkcionalnosti, ki jih ni mogoče enostavno doseči z drugimi tehnologijami, kot so HTML in CSS sami. Z JavaScript-om lahko ustvarite gladke animacije, uporabniške dogodke in samodejno drsenje, vse z minimalnim naporom.
Osnovni koraki za ustvarjanje JavaScript Carousela
Začnimo z ustvarjanjem enostavnega vrtiljaka slik s pomočjo HTML, CSS in JavaScript. Tukaj je osnovni primer kode, ki jo bomo uporabili kot izhodišče:
JavaScript Carousel
Kako deluje ta JavaScript Carousel?
V tem primeru imamo preprost carousel z dvema gumboma: "prejšnji" in "naslednji". Ko kliknemo na enega od gumbov, se spremeni "currentIndex" – to je indeks trenutne slike, ki se prikazuje. Z uporabo funkcije `updateCarousel()` poskrbimo, da se slike premaknejo v desno ali levo, kar ustvarja efekt premikanja.
Dodajanje samodejnega premikanja
Če želite, da se vaš carousel samodejno premika brez potrebe po interakciji uporabnika, lahko dodate preprosto funkcionalnost za samodejno drsenje. Tukaj je primer, kako to doseči z uporabo `setInterval` funkcije:
Ta koda bo vsakih 3 sekunde premaknila sliko naprej. Tako bo vaš carousel vedno v gibanju, tudi če uporabnik ne klikne nobenega gumba.
Dodajanje več funkcionalnosti
Zdaj, ko imamo osnovni carousel, si poglejmo nekaj drugih funkcionalnosti, ki jih lahko dodamo za izboljšanje uporabniške izkušnje:
- Animacije prehoda: S pomočjo CSS lahko dodate gladke prehode med slikami, kar bo vašemu carouselu dalo bolj profesionalen videz.
- Števci in označevalci: Dodajte števce ali označevalce, da uporabnikom pokažete, katero sliko trenutno gledajo.
- Mobilna optimizacija: Poskrbite, da bo vaš carousel dobro deloval tudi na mobilnih napravah z uporabo medijskih poizvedb (media queries).
Zaključek
JavaScript carousel je odličen način za izboljšanje izgleda in funkcionalnosti vaše spletne strani. S pomočjo zgoraj omenjenih primerov in nasvetov lahko hitro ustvarite svoj lasten dinamičen carousel, ki bo popestril vašo stran. Ne pozabite, da je JavaScript izredno prilagodljiv, kar pomeni, da lahko prilagodite vrtiljak svojim potrebam. Uporabite ta vodič, da boste obvladali osnove in začeli ustvarjati profesionalne spletne strani z vrtiljaki!

Komentarze (0) - Nikt jeszcze nie komentował - bądź pierwszy!